
South Korea Orbital Welding Machine Market Overview
The South Korea orbital welding machine market has experienced significant growth over recent years, driven by the country’s robust industrial base and technological advancements. As of 2023, the market size is estimated to be valued at approximately USD 250 million, with projections indicating a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of around 7.5% during the forecast period of 2024 to 2029. This growth is fueled by increasing demand across sectors such as shipbuilding, petrochemicals, electronics, and automotive manufacturing, which require precise and efficient welding solutions. The expanding industrial landscape, coupled with modernization initiatives, positions South Korea as a key player in the regional orbital welding equipment ecosystem. Market analysts anticipate that technological innovations and the adoption of advanced automation systems will further propel market expansion, making orbital welding machines indispensable for high-quality, repeatable welds in complex applications.
